Wauchope residents and visitors are advised that access to Werrikimbe National Park is currently restricted following adverse weather conditions. Roads within and leading to the park have sustained damage, with some sections now requiring a 4WD vehicle, while others are completely closed.

Road Access Update:

The Hastings Forest Way and Racecourse Road are both open, but extreme caution is advised, and only 4WD vehicles should attempt these routes. Forbes Road also remains open with caution for 4WDs. However, Cockerawombeeba Road is closed between Forbes Road and North Plateau Road, and Rimau Road is also impassable.

Park Closures:

Due to a significant tree fall, North Plateau Road, Plateau Beech Campground, and the King Fern Walking Track within Werrikimbe National Park are currently closed to all visitors. Brushy Mountain Campground, however, remains open.

Visitors are urged to exercise extreme caution, particularly when approaching waterway crossings such as the Forbes River crossing on Racecourse Road, and to check water depths before proceeding. These measures are in place to ensure the safety of all park users.
